Transaction 43bdaa46caf19902512bc2820d51d6a39b3a6ccf1c40962ec0d087a91ebf53af

1 Input
2 Outputs
  • 43bdaa46caf19902512bc2820d51d6a39b3a6ccf1c40962ec0d087a91ebf53af:0
  • value  250050203
    address  13gGe1makYNDEKpqep4EgmXgcnRLJ1QFxV
  • 43bdaa46caf19902512bc2820d51d6a39b3a6ccf1c40962ec0d087a91ebf53af:1
  • value  50000000
    address  3QCSL6FUiMJ4dWaWF6BmRK2GNFBQg2WsWD